Originally Posted by Bartolo
Not sure if this is the correct thread, so mods feel free to move.

Looking at a few transborder flights, different itineraries. In almost every case there is a difference between the points amount on the app and on the website. Usually 3000 or 4000 pts. Typically app is more points but my sample size is relatively small. Compared revenue prices for same itineraries and generally the same but on a few occasions there is a couple of dollars difference between the website and the app. Has anyone else seen this?

Followup thought re tx price difference between website and app — website prompts me to sign in for best price. I proceeded without doing that. I was signed into the app from a previous session. Perhaps loyalty/status gives different pricing? This is only a guess. I have never seen that happen prior to the new program. Perhaps there is another explanation entirely.
Status and having an Aeroplan credit card get you preferential pricing since the new program was implemented last year.

If you sign in to the website and see different pricing between that and the app, then yes, there's an issue somewhere.

If you weren't signed in on the website when you did those searches, you can't directly compare the pricing to the app.
